Nadia Ahmad is a visiting lecturer at Boston University School of Law, where she teaches legal research to first year law students and LLM students. Her primary research interest is in the area of international human rights law. Her doctoral dissertation, for which she was awarded an SJD (Doctor of Juridical Science) by the Case Western Reserve University School of Law,  focused on developing a legal framework for armed humanitarian interventions.Previously, she earned an LLM in International Law from the University of Michigan Law School, and completed her BA and LLB from the Lahore University of Management Sciences, in Pakistan.She has taught Public International Law, International Human Rights, and Legal Writing and Research at law schools in the Middle East and Pakistan. She is a member of the New York Bar.
